Transaction ec59ad2bee1148fba275907648c998392c344cf4450b74dbaa9f81852a1471f1
1 Input
1 Output
-
ec59ad2bee1148fba275907648c998392c344cf4450b74dbaa9f81852a1471f1:0
- value
- 3891387
- script pubkey
- OP_0 OP_PUSHBYTES_20 b6914482eb8d17d6036b79933892ab696d0d40ce
- address
- bc1qk6g5fqht35tavqmt0xfn3y4td9ks6sxw6cmmnt